使用Oracle数据库备份与恢复的SQL语句(oracle备份语句)

随着行业日益竞争,数据维护安全性和可用性变得越来越重要。Oracle数据库备份与恢复是数据维护,故障恢复和安全性管理中最重要的项目之一。对于 Oracle 客户端数据库,使用 SQL 语句可以完成数据库备份与恢复的操作,本文将详细讨论 Oracle 数据库备份与恢复的SQL语句。

使用 Oracle 数据库备份时,首先需要使用SQL语句来指定备份数据库的参数。使用下面的代码可以在Oracle数据库中设置备份数据库参数:

“`SQL

ALTER SYSTEM SET db_recovery_file_dest_size=20G SCOPE=BOTH;

ALTER SYSTEM SET db_recovery_file_dest=’c:\backup’ SCOPE=BOTH;


接下来,就可以使用SQL语句完成数据库备份操作了。这里,使用的备份SQL语句可能如下:

```SQL
BACKUP DATABASE plus archivelog;

使用该语句可以备份数据库,并生成一系列归档日志。在紧急情况下,可以通过使用SQL语句完成数据库的恢复操作,语句如下:

“`SQL

STARTUP nomount;

SET UNTIL TIME “2018-10-13 11:30:20”;

RESTORE DATABASE;

RECOVER DATABASE;

ALTER DATABASE OPEN RESETLOGS;


以上就是完成 Oracle 数据库备份与恢复SQL语句实例,通过备份和恢复,可以有效地保护用户数据及系统资源。为了确保在紧急情况下也能及时完成数据库备份和恢复操作,建议将上述SQL语句放入脚本中保存,以便快速使用。

数据运维技术 » 使用Oracle数据库备份与恢复的SQL语句(oracle备份语句)